内射在线CHINESE,久久久久久亚洲精品,中文字幕一区在线观看视频,扒开女人两片毛茸茸黑森林

您的位置:首頁 > 行業(yè)資訊 > 小程序?qū)崟r(shí)更新與部署解決方案

小程序?qū)崟r(shí)更新與部署解決方案

發(fā)布時(shí)間:2024-10-10 09:40:03 來源: www.tianwaitian.net 156次瀏覽 作者:成都碼鄰蜀小程序開發(fā)公司

小程序?qū)崟r(shí)更新與部署解決方案,小程序?qū)崟r(shí)更新與部署解決方案

**小程序解決方案實(shí)時(shí)更新和部署**

一、簡介

隨著移動(dòng)互聯(lián)網(wǎng)的快速發(fā)展,小程序作為一種輕量級的應(yīng)用形式,已經(jīng)成為現(xiàn)代互聯(lián)網(wǎng)生態(tài)系統(tǒng)中不可或缺的一部分。小程序因其簡單、快捷、跨平臺(tái)等特點(diǎn),迅速贏得了用戶和開發(fā)者的青睞。然而,在快速迭代的網(wǎng)絡(luò)環(huán)境下,如何實(shí)現(xiàn)小程序的實(shí)時(shí)更新和部署,成為小程序開發(fā)過程中需要面對的重要問題。本文將對小程序?qū)崟r(shí)更新部署的背景、意義、技術(shù)實(shí)現(xiàn)、案例分析等進(jìn)行闡述,以期為小程序開發(fā)者提供一定的參考和幫助。

2、小程序?qū)崟r(shí)更新部署的背景和意義

小程序自誕生以來,以其便捷的體驗(yàn)和豐富的功能迅速占領(lǐng)市場。然而,隨著網(wǎng)絡(luò)技術(shù)的快速發(fā)展和用戶需求的不斷變化,小程序的更新和部署變得越來越頻繁。傳統(tǒng)的更新方式往往需要開發(fā)者手動(dòng)發(fā)布新版本,用戶需要重新下載安裝才能體驗(yàn)新功能或修復(fù)bug,這無疑增加了用戶的運(yùn)營成本,降低了用戶體驗(yàn)。因此,實(shí)現(xiàn)小程序的實(shí)時(shí)更新和部署對于提升用戶體驗(yàn)、加速開發(fā)迭代、提高應(yīng)用穩(wěn)定性具有重要意義。

3、小程序?qū)崟r(shí)更新部署的技術(shù)實(shí)現(xiàn)

1、云開發(fā)技術(shù)

云開發(fā)技術(shù)為小程序的實(shí)時(shí)更新和部署提供了強(qiáng)大的支持。通過云開發(fā)平臺(tái),開發(fā)者可以將小程序的代碼部署到云端,利用云服務(wù)器強(qiáng)大的計(jì)算能力和存儲(chǔ)能力,實(shí)現(xiàn)小程序的實(shí)時(shí)更新和部署。云開發(fā)平臺(tái)提供豐富的API接口和開發(fā)工具,可以輕松實(shí)現(xiàn)前后端分離的開發(fā)模式,提高開發(fā)效率。

2.代碼編譯與打包

在小程序的開發(fā)過程中,代碼編譯和打包是必不可少的環(huán)節(jié)。代碼通過編譯器編譯成機(jī)器可執(zhí)行的二進(jìn)制代碼,然后打包生成可以在小程序平臺(tái)上運(yùn)行的應(yīng)用程序包。在此過程中,開發(fā)者可以利用各種工具和技術(shù)手段對代碼進(jìn)行優(yōu)化和壓縮,以提高應(yīng)用程序的運(yùn)行效率和用戶體驗(yàn)。

3、服務(wù)器端推送技術(shù)

服務(wù)器端推送技術(shù)是實(shí)現(xiàn)小程序?qū)崟r(shí)更新的關(guān)鍵。通過服務(wù)器向小程序發(fā)送更新通知。小程序收到通知后,自動(dòng)下載并安裝新版本的應(yīng)用程序包。這種方式無需用戶手動(dòng)下載并安裝新版本,從而提高了用戶體驗(yàn)。同時(shí),服務(wù)器端推送技術(shù)還可以實(shí)現(xiàn)對應(yīng)用的實(shí)時(shí)監(jiān)控和預(yù)警,及時(shí)發(fā)現(xiàn)并解決應(yīng)用問題。

4.版本控制和回滾

為了保證應(yīng)用的穩(wěn)定性和可維護(hù)性,開發(fā)者需要使用版本控制技術(shù)來管理小程序的代碼。通過版本控制工具,您可以輕松查看和管理不同版本的代碼,并實(shí)現(xiàn)代碼回滾和比較。當(dāng)應(yīng)用程序出現(xiàn)問題時(shí),可以通過回滾到之前的版本來快速修復(fù)問題,保證應(yīng)用程序的正常運(yùn)行。

4、小程序?qū)崟r(shí)更新部署案例分析

以某電商平臺(tái)小程序?yàn)槔?。小程序采用云開發(fā)技術(shù),實(shí)現(xiàn)實(shí)時(shí)更新和部署。當(dāng)開發(fā)者發(fā)布新功能或者修復(fù)bug時(shí),只需將新版本的代碼推送到云服務(wù)器,云端就會(huì)自動(dòng)編譯打包生成新的應(yīng)用程序包。同時(shí),服務(wù)器通過推送技術(shù)向小程序發(fā)送更新通知,小程序收到通知后自動(dòng)下載并安裝新版本的應(yīng)用程序包。這種方式不僅提高了用戶體驗(yàn),還加快了開發(fā)迭代。當(dāng)應(yīng)用出現(xiàn)問題時(shí),開發(fā)者可以通過版本控制工具快速回滾到之前的版本,保證應(yīng)用的穩(wěn)定性。

5. 結(jié)論

小程序作為一種輕量級的應(yīng)用形式,實(shí)時(shí)更新和部署對于提升用戶體驗(yàn)、加速開發(fā)迭代、提高應(yīng)用穩(wěn)定性具有重要意義。通過云開發(fā)技術(shù)、代碼編譯打包、服務(wù)器端推送技術(shù)、版本控制和回滾等技術(shù)手段的實(shí)施,可以有效實(shí)現(xiàn)小程序的實(shí)時(shí)更新和部署。未來,隨著技術(shù)的不斷發(fā)展和創(chuàng)新,小程序的開發(fā)和運(yùn)營將更加便捷和高效。

文章轉(zhuǎn)載請聯(lián)系作者并注明出處:http://www.tianwaitian.net/news/2706.html

上一個(gè): 打造完美小程序:設(shè)計(jì)到實(shí)施的用戶體驗(yàn)優(yōu)化之旅 下一個(gè): 微信小商店的商業(yè)模式及其未來發(fā)展

相關(guān)資訊

COPYRIGHT (?) 2018-2025- 成都碼鄰蜀科技有限公司 備案:蜀ICP備18034030號-8